Residential Electric Rates

Please check with your electric utility for your current electric delivery rate by clicking on the utility link below. These are the average residential electric rates by utility. This includes transmission, distribution, stranded costs, and standard offer supply rates. Customers who have chosen a competitive electricity supplier will have different rates. Rates will also vary by individual usage and customer class.

Transmission, distribution, and stranded costs rates may be affected by so-called “deferred accounting.” Deferred accounting is an important regulatory tool that may be used to provide rate stability or rate smoothing and minimize rate fluctuation over time. Deferred accounting involves either (1) delaying the recovery of costs that the utility has incurred (either partially or entirely) or (2) delaying the return to ratepayers of amounts the utility has received or costs that have been reduced (either partially or entirely) until the costs or revenues are incorporated in rates. In lay terms, deferred accounting creates a “loan” from the utilities to the utility’s ratepayers or vice versa. 

When a cost or revenue has been deferred its rate impact may not be known until it has been approved for appropriate rate treatment in a subsequent rate case. Thus, the residential electricity rates stated below on this webpage would not include some deferred costs/revenues that the Commission has authorized to potentially be included in distribution or stranded costs rates in the future (or with respect to transmission rates, that the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ission has authorized). However, those rates do include deferred costs/revenues that the Commission has already approved in a prior rate case for incorporation in distribution or stranded cost rates. 

For example, the Commission has authorized the recovery in distribution rates of certain costs associated with Central Maine Power Company’s response to particular storms. The chart below illustrates how storm costs are incorporated into rates over time. As one can see, 2019 and 2020 storm costs were each recovered over three years; 2021 storm costs were recovered in one year; and 2022 storm costs will be recovered over two years.
